#896453 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#896453 is composed of 53.7% red, 39.2%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27% magenta, 39.4%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 18.9 degrees, a saturation of 24.5% and a lightness of 43.1%. #896453 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8a6 with #130000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#896453 color description : Mostly desaturated dark orange.

#896453 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#896453 has RGB values of R:137, G:100,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.39,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 9004115.

Shades and Tints of #896453

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030202 is the darkest color, while #f9f7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#896453

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706d6c is the less saturated color, while #d54807 is the most saturated one.
